Description
The MAX3232EEUE+ is a versatile RS-232 transceiver from Maxim Integrated designed for serial communication applications. It operates with a dual supply voltage, ranging from 3.0V to 5.5V, making it suitable for both 3V and 5V logic systems. The device features two drivers and two receivers, which facilitate the conversion between TTL/CMOS logic levels and RS-232 standard levels, enabling reliable data transmission over serial ports.
One of the key advantages of the MAX3232EEUE+ is its low-power consumption, making it ideal for battery-powered applications. It incorporates a charge-pump voltage converter that eliminates the need for external capacitors, thus simplifying design and reducing cost and space on the PCB. Additionally, the device supports data rates up to 250 kbps, ensuring efficient communication for various applications.
Housed in a 16-pin TSSOP package, the MAX3232EEUE+ is well-suited for compact designs. Its wide operating temperature range from -40°C to +85°C ensures reliability in diverse environments, making it a popular choice for embedded systems, industrial automation, and mobile devices.

Features
The MAX3232EEUE+ is a RS-232 transceiver designed by Maxim Integrated. It features two drivers and two receivers to facilitate communication between TTL/CMOS logic levels and RS-232 standards. Key features include:
1. Voltage Range: Operates from a single 3.0V to 5.5V power supply.
2. Low Power Consumption: Incorporates a 1µA low-power shutdown mode.
3. Data Rate: Supports data rates up to 250 kbps, ensuring reliable data transmission.
4. ESD Protection: Provides ±15kV ESD protection on RS-232 bus pins for enhanced reliability.
5. Auto Shutdown: Automatically reduces power consumption when the device is not in use.
6. Small Package: Available in a compact TSSOP package, saving board space.
7. Capacitor Requirement: Requires only four small external capacitors, simplifying design.
These features make the MAX3232EEUE+ suitable for battery-powered and portable applications, ensuring efficient and robust serial communication.

Pinout
The MAX3232EEUE+ is a dual-channel RS-232 line driver/receiver designed for communication between a DTE and DCE. It is typically used in serial communication applications to convert signals between RS-232 and TTL/CMOS logic levels. This IC is part of the MAX3232 family, which is known for operating at lower voltages compared to traditional RS-232 transceivers.
The MAX3232EEUE+ comes in a 16-pin TSSOP (Thin Shrink Small Outline Package). The pin functions are as follows:
1. VCC: Power supply input.
2. GND: Ground.
3. C1+: Positive terminal for the external charge pump capacitor.
4. C1-: Negative terminal for the external charge pump capacitor.
5. C2+: Positive terminal for the second external charge pump capacitor.
6. C2-: Negative terminal for the second external charge pump capacitor.
7. V+: Positive voltage generated by the charge pump.
8. V-: Negative voltage generated by the charge pump.
9-10. T1IN, T2IN: TTL/CMOS input from the UART.
11-12. R1OUT, R2OUT: TTL/CMOS output to the UART.
13-14. T1OUT, T2OUT: RS-232 output to the serial cable.
15-16. R1IN, R2IN: RS-232 input from the serial cable.
This IC is suitable for applications requiring reliable serial communication in low-voltage environments.

Application
The MAX3232EEUE+ is a RS-232 transceiver commonly used in various applications requiring serial communication interfacing. Key application areas include:
1. Industrial Automation: Facilitates communication between industrial control equipment and computers.
2. Embedded Systems: Allows microcontrollers to interface with PCs or other devices.
3. Networking Equipment: Used in routers, modems, and switches for serial data transmission.
4. POS Systems: Enables communication between point-of-sale terminals and peripherals.
5. Medical Devices: Connects diagnostic and monitoring equipment via serial interfaces.
6. Consumer Electronics: Utilized in devices like set-top boxes and gaming consoles for serial communication.
Its ability to operate at low voltages makes it suitable for battery-powered applications.
